AG says some farmers in the North have lost 70 sheep, goats and cattle
Agriculture Minister to announce assistance soon

Attorney General and Minister for Economy, Aiyaz Sayed-Khaiyum says some farmers they have visited in Bua have lost about 70 goats, sheep and cattle on their farm.

While speaking to the residents of Vunivau in Labasa, Sayed-Khaiyum says a lot of the farmers in Wainikoro in Labasa, Lekutu and Dreketi have lost everything on their farms.

Sayed-Khaiyum says the Minister for Agriculture, Dr. Mahendra Reddy will be announcing something soon about the agriculture assistance that will be given to the farmers.

Reddy has said they are planning to provide farmers with planting materials.

He said the agricultural officers are on the ground to conduct an assessment to put a dollar value to the damages after which they will be able to assist these farmers in the long term.
